Tell background. There have been debates over many years on who wrot the book of Hebrews. Some say it was Paul because of the time it was written, but others say it is not like his style of writing however, we do know it was written by one of Jesus beleivers who understood the character of Christ and how we should live for him, serve others and love one another.
